Durability
The life expectancy of a leather sofa is contingent on the quality of the fabric and how well it is maintained. If you're willing to spend the time and effort to clean and maintain your sofa, it will last at minimum 20 years. If you don't, the sofa may not last that long. It's also dependent on how the sofa is used. Leather is extremely durable and is resistant to rips and tears making it an ideal option for families with children or pets. It is also easy to clean. Spills and stains can be removed easily and dust is brushed off with minimal effort.
The type of leather you choose can also impact the longevity of your couch. Currier's sells only top-grain or full-grain leather that is more durable. Faux leather isn't as durable and can begin to peel after several years of usage. Bonded leather, made from pieces of genuine leather glued to each other is less durable than genuine.
You can determine the durability of a sofa by looking at the label. Look for words such as "pigmented" and "aniline." These leathers are more durable and more durable than other kinds of leather. They also resist stains better than other types of leather.
Other elements that affect durability are the frame, suspension, and cushioning of your sofa. Hand-tied springs, for example are more durable than other types of springs because they are secured by hand using precise craftsmanship. They are also more expensive, however, than other types.

Value
When shopping for a sofa, it is important to consider the true price. A leather sofa could cost more than fabric, but due to its durability and long-lasting nature you'll only have to replace it two or three times in your lifetime. This makes leather sofas a great value.
The price of a leather couch set will vary greatly based on the kind and the frame of the leather. Generally, full-grain leather is the most durable however, it can be more expensive than faux or bonded leather. Leather is a natural material that will have imperfections. However, modern tanning techniques can help minimize these flaws.
